Estimation of 30Ne(n;γ)31Ne capture reaction by semi-analytic approaches

Description

A nuclear halo is an intriguing phenomenon discovered in the mid-80's near the limits of nuclear stability. In this work, the cross-section of 30Ne(n,γ)31Ne capture reaction by examining the electric dipole response dB(E1)/dEc to the continuum has been calculated
